@Paul T I think the 20s are really helped by the larger cuff. I actually just finished hot soaking these. I was trying to replicate what I did with the first pair and I’m thinking I hot washed them in the machine and then dried. This time I cold washed and dried. The leg twist wasn’t quite as dramatic, which to me, is a good way to tell if the shrinking is done.

yo... I've been busy with school, then SuFu broke for me, so i'm finally getting around to uploading these. I got the jeans on the morning of the 14th so i immediately put them on and wore them to school for the day. The denim was initially way more dark and grey, with a very stiff texture. very crunchy. Aftter the soak the colour lightened up the the deep blue i remembered. I washed on hot with a very hot dry cycle for an hour. i think i got all the shrink out of them right off the bat. After the soak the denim was like crumpled paper. the denim had a crazy amount of texture, i was a little concerned i overdid it with the extra hot dry but it calmed down in a couple wears. Super happy the jeans are back i was missing them quite a bit. I'm not too peeved about the pockets, except they kind of feel smaller than the old ones, maybe i'm crazy... I don't have my measurements right now, i noted them down but i forgot them at my place(writing this at a friends house). I tried to cuff the pants to the same length so you could see how much they shrunk.
